Marshall Buck on [sage-support] writes:
It is a shame that normal arithmetic for polys over GF(2) still seems
to be implemented by the ntl ZZ_pX library, which is usually at least
10 times slower than GF2X, up to degree 217 anyway. In that range
GF2X matches the speed of magma.
